17086579 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 17086580. Its totient is φ = 17086578.
The previous prime is 17086571. The next prime is 17086583. The reversal of 17086579 is 97568071.
It is a strong pr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 17086579 - 23 = 17086571 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(17086571)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(11)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 8543289 + 8543290.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(8543290).
Almost surely, 217086579 is an apocalyptic number.
17086579 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
17086579 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
17086579 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 105840, while the sum is 43.
The square root of 17086579 is about 4133.5915376341. The cubic root of 17086579 is about 257.5639279490.
The spelling of 17086579 in words is "seventeen million, eighty-six thousand, five hundred seventy-nine".
